Sarpong read Article 94 (a) of the 1992 Constitution. If you do not have a copy, please proceed to the Assembly Press to buy one. It only costs GHC5. Please do not comment on issues you have no knowledge. For the sat time, I will do you a favour by quoting the Article verbatim: Article 4 (a) - SUBJECT TO THE PROVISIONS OF THIS ARTICLE, A PERSON SHALL NOT BE QUALIFIED TO BE A MEMBER OF PARLIAMENT UNLESS:
(A) HE IS A CITIZEN OF GHANA, HAS ATTAINED THE AGE OF 21 YEARS AND IS A REGISTERED VOTER (CAPS MINE).
